Timezone in San Martino al Cimino
San Martino al Cimino is located in the Europe/Rome timezone, which operates on Central European Time (CET) with a UTC offset of +1 hour during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, which typically runs from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the timezone shifts to Central European Summer Time (CEST), resulting in a UTC offset of +2 hours. When considering the difference to the United States, San Martino al Cimino is generally 6 to 9 hours ahead, depending on the U.S. time zone.
For example, when it is noon in San Martino al Cimino, it is typically 6 AM in New York (Eastern Time) and 3 AM in Los Angeles (Pacific Time). Attractions and Activities in San Martino al Cimino
San Martino al Cimino is a small town in the Lazio region of Italy, located near Viterbo. This charming area is known for its picturesque landscapes, featuring rolling hills and lush greenery typical of the Italian countryside. The town’s historical roots are evident in its architecture, with narrow streets and quaint buildings that reflect the local heritage.
A significant landmark in San Martino al Cimino is the Abbey of San Martino, a former Benedictine monastery dating back to the 11th century. This site showcases beautiful Romanesque architecture and offers visitors a glimpse into the region’s religious history. Practical Information for Visitors
San Martino al Cimino is a charming village in Italy, situated near Viterbo. The nearest major airport is Leonardo da Vinci International Airport in Rome, approximately 100 kilometers away. From the airport, visitors can take a train to Viterbo Porta Romana and then a bus or taxi to reach San Martino al Cimino.
Alternatively, Viterbo is well-connected by train from Rome, making it easy to explore the region. The climate in San Martino al Cimino is Mediterranean, featuring hot summers and mild winters. The best time to visit is during the spring and early autumn when temperatures are pleasant and the landscape is lush.
Expect average highs of around 20-25 degrees Celsius in these seasons, making it ideal for outdoor activities.
